Output 8c73587ecb7f6087e1d04d11ae9790c26f1825a682eba6c075400d7b5908710d:12

value
50603632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5198ecac30c67dc392a5a0d149dc3e9056c49e4 OP_EQUAL
address
MQQj9wKFiLDdAixtcrG5awL2XnA7TNB363
transaction
8c73587ecb7f6087e1d04d11ae9790c26f1825a682eba6c075400d7b5908710d
spent
true